1. An electric power transmission system that isolates a local AC transmission network from a surrounding AC system, comprising:

  • (a) a local AC load center having a plurality of local AC loads, and at least one distribution feeder serving the plurality of local AC loads;

    (b) at least one distant electric power generating station for supplying AC power to the local AC load center by means of an AC transmission line;

    (c) a DC transmission ring having a plurality of DC loads thereon at least partially interposed between the local AC load center and the distant electric power generating station, the DC transmission ring isolating the AC power received from the distant electric power generating station from the local AC load center;

    (d) a first plurality of AC/DC converters electrically interfaced with the DC transmission ring exterior to the local AC load center for converting the AC power from the distant generating station into DC power and making available the DC power converted at a one of the AC/DC converters to at least some of the other of the plurality of DC loads on the DC transmission ring;

    (e) a second plurality of AC/DC converters electrically interfaced with the DC transmission ring interior to the DC transmission ring for converting the DC power from the DC transmission ring into AC power;

    (f) the distribution feeder proximate the local AC load center electrically connected to the DC transmission ring through the second plurality of AC/DC converters for supplying the AC power to the local AC load center while all local AC loads are isolated from the distant electric power generating station.
